LV to pursue more flights after merger

Thursday, Dec. 23, 1999 | 11:19 a.m.

Las Vegas aviation officials say they will lobby Air Canada for additional flights to Las Vegas from north of the border if the airline's pending merger with Canadian Airlines Corp. is completed as planned.

Montreal-based Air Canada is evaluating how it would increase service if it were to acquire Canadian Airlines' fleet. One of its proposals is to increase the frequency of flights between Toronto, Ontario, and Las Vegas. Air Canada currently operates round-trip flights Thursdays and Sundays on Boeing 767 jumbo jets between Las Vegas and the two cities.
